Talk to a person, not at. Listen to what they say. Their ideas (questions) may be right even if the answers are wrong. Don't Argue, try seeing thing's from their point of view.

Talking at a person mean you're not listening and don't care what they have to say. (Belittling)

Advice from William Casey to Robert Gates: A good Leader listen to others with an open mine. You have to separate the chaff from the wheat. Their ideas maybe 90% wrong but the 10% maybe a new approach to the problem you are trying to solve. Robert M Gates: A Passion for Leadership.
